The sum of 3 consecutive odd numbers is 183. What is the third number in this sequence?
natta225 [31]

Answer:

61

Step-by-step explanation:

3x + 6 = 183

3x = 177

x = 59

(x+2) = (59+2) = 61

It is correct on khan academy

Combine like terms - y + 9z - 16y - 25z + 4
alexandr402 [8]

- 17y - 16z + 4

Step-by-step explanation:

1) Collect like terms.

( - y - 16y) + (9z - 25z) + 4

2) Simplify.

- 17y - 16z + 4

So, therefor, the answer is -17y - 16z + 4.
